pharma bottle filling machine

The pharma bottle filling machine represents a pinnacle of precision engineering in pharmaceutical manufacturing, designed to meet the exacting standards of pharmaceutical production. This sophisticated equipment automates the crucial process of filling pharmaceutical bottles with various liquid medications, ensuring accurate dosage and maintaining sterile conditions throughout the operation. The machine incorporates advanced servo-driven technology for precise volume control, coupled with sophisticated sensing systems that monitor fill levels and detect any anomalies during the filling process. Its modular design typically includes multiple filling stations, bottle positioning mechanisms, and integrated cleaning systems that maintain hygiene standards. The machine can handle various bottle sizes and shapes, with quick-change parts enabling rapid format transitions. Operating speeds can reach up to several hundred bottles per minute, depending on the model and configuration. The system includes automated bottle feeding, alignment mechanisms, and post-filling quality checks to ensure consistency. Modern pharma filling machines also feature programmable logic controllers (PLCs) that allow for recipe management and provide detailed production data for compliance documentation. The equipment is constructed from pharmaceutical-grade stainless steel and features clean-in-place (CIP) systems for efficient sanitization. Advanced models incorporate laminar airflow protection and HEPA filtration to maintain sterile filling conditions, making them suitable for both sterile and non-sterile pharmaceutical products.

The pharma bottle filling machine offers numerous advantages that significantly enhance pharmaceutical manufacturing operations. First, it dramatically improves production efficiency by automating the filling process, reducing labor costs while increasing output capacity. The precision filling technology ensures exact dosage consistency, minimizing product waste and ensuring regulatory compliance. The automated system virtually eliminates human error in the filling process, leading to higher quality standards and fewer rejected products. The machines feature rapid changeover capabilities, allowing manufacturers to switch between different bottle sizes and products quickly, maximizing production flexibility and reducing downtime. Advanced cleaning systems and sterile design features maintain strict hygiene standards while minimizing contamination risks. The integrated quality control systems perform real-time monitoring, ensuring each bottle meets exact specifications before proceeding to the next production stage. Modern machines include data logging and tracking capabilities, simplifying compliance documentation and providing valuable production analytics. The equipment's robust construction ensures long-term reliability and reduced maintenance requirements, leading to lower operational costs over time. Safety features protect operators while maintaining efficient production flow. The machines support various filling technologies, including volumetric, weight-based, and time-pressure systems, accommodating different product viscosities and characteristics. Energy-efficient design elements reduce utility costs while maintaining optimal performance. The systems interface seamlessly with other packaging line equipment, creating a streamlined production process. Remote monitoring capabilities allow for proactive maintenance and quick troubleshooting, minimizing unexpected downtime.

Advanced Precision Control System

Advanced Precision Control System

The precision control system represents the cornerstone of the pharma bottle filling machine's capabilities. This sophisticated system utilizes state-of-the-art servo motors and advanced sensors to achieve unprecedented filling accuracy. The technology maintains consistency within microliter tolerances, ensuring exact dosage in every bottle. Real-time feedback mechanisms continuously monitor and adjust filling parameters, compensating for variations in product viscosity or environmental conditions. The system includes multiple check points that verify fill volumes, detecting and rejecting any bottles that fall outside specified parameters. This precision control extends to the entire filling process, from initial bottle positioning to final cap torque verification. The system's intelligent algorithms can adapt to different product characteristics, maintaining accuracy across various pharmaceutical formulations. This level of control not only ensures product quality but also minimizes waste and optimizes resource utilization.
Integrated Clean Room Technology

Integrated Clean Room Technology

The integrated clean room technology establishes a controlled environment critical for pharmaceutical production. The system incorporates HEPA filtration systems that maintain ISO-classified cleanliness levels throughout the filling operation. Laminar airflow patterns prevent contamination by creating a consistent, filtered air barrier around the filling area. The machine's design includes sealed filling chambers with positive pressure differentials that prevent the ingress of environmental contaminants. Material selection focuses on cleanroom-compatible surfaces that resist particle generation and facilitate effective cleaning. The clean room technology includes automated cleaning validation systems that document sanitization effectiveness. Advanced monitoring systems continuously track environmental parameters, including particle counts, temperature, and humidity, ensuring optimal conditions for pharmaceutical filling operations.
Smart Production Management Interface

Smart Production Management Interface

The smart production management interface revolutionizes how operators interact with and control the filling process. This intuitive system provides comprehensive real-time monitoring of all critical parameters through a user-friendly touchscreen interface. Operators can access detailed production data, modify filling parameters, and track batch records with minimal training. The interface includes recipe management capabilities that allow quick product changeovers while maintaining accurate documentation. Built-in quality control modules automatically generate compliance reports and maintain electronic batch records. The system features predictive maintenance algorithms that alert operators to potential issues before they impact production. Remote access capabilities enable technical support and troubleshooting without requiring on-site presence. The interface integrates with enterprise management systems, facilitating seamless data exchange and production planning.
